The series that put DICE on the map is coming at us in full force at the NYCC. They have revealed not just one, but two Battlefield-themed games for us to drool over, Battlefield: Bad Company 2 and Battlefield: 1943. BF:BC2 makes a pleasantly surprising appearance on the PC platform as its predecessor was noticeably absent the first time around. It’s described as having a “level of fervor to vehicular warfare never before experienced in a modern warfare action game.” Music to my ears.
BF:1943 looks to be a cross platform rehash of BF:1942 complete with the popular Wake map and much improved graphics and physics. The destructible environments alone make it worth while even if it is a rehash. It will be multiplayer only and available on the same platforms as BF:BC2 – PC, Xbox 360 and PS3. Although BF:BC2 is not slated to release until sometime next year, BF:1943 is set to release this summer. Between these two games and the inevitable release of Battlefield: Heroes we are getting our fair share of Battlefield saturation in the next couple years.
